Ngaru is the Maori word for "wave". The wave motif in this hat pattern draws heavy influence from [taaniko][1] (traditional Maori weaving) designs and motifs. This pattern is rather special to me, as it is my first to incorporate such designs as a method to connect with my mother's culture.
Yarns used:
- 1 Skein of Cascade 220 Worsted Black (Main Color)
- 1 Skein of Cascade 220 Worsted Red (Contrast Color)
Yardage:
- Approx. 125 yards of MC yarn
- Approx. 20 yards of CC yarn
(This yardage includes yarn usage for making the pom-pom)
Needle: Size 7 and 8 circular needles or DNPs (you can use which ever method for circular knitting for hats as you like.
Gauge: 5 sts per 1 inch, 6 rows per 1 inch on size 8 needles (after blocking).
Final Dimensions: 8 inches tall, 21-22” circumference (after blocking). Has enough stretch to fit 24” inch heads (though the height will shorten a bit)
